new reminded me that I have to let you all know about this awesome Hanukkah present from my mother-in-law: a book of temporary tattoos for librarians. Check this out: "I Heart Dewey Decimal System!"
Here's a close-up with my hair out of the way.

Some of the other included illustrations for your favorite librarian are "Book Lust," "Literate 4 Life," and "Alas, Poor Yorick." My favorite is a skull wielding an "overdue" stamp. The book is titled "The Illustrated Librarian: 12 Temporary Tattoos for Librarians and Booklovers.
